Job description

Duration: 6-12 months
Pay: $26.50/hr
Location: Tampa
Hybrid: WFH Mon & Fri, onsite Tue, Wed and Thur
40 hours/week

Organized, detail oriented, and versatile Buy Ready Specialist with excellent communication skills that supports the Production Art Team in processing seasonal line plans. The Buy Ready specialist executes the production process, including tracking the production calendar and ensuring on-time product delivery. You should have experience following style guides and branding. This is not a design role, rather, you are making sure that physical comps match the designs.

Responsibilities:
• Supports production art and product development to ensure products are executed with design specifications.
• Assists in the approval process and timeline to ensure accuracy and avoid delivery impact.
• Executes the requesting and tracking of product components, league samples and on field / on ice strike off’s to ensure accurate league representation.
• Establish and maintain vendor tool box along with internal approval libraries.
• Continuously communicates to all cross functional partners on production updates, approvals, and issues.
• Maintains working relationships with outside partners and vendors.
• Identifies and manages issues to resolution
• Identifies and recommends areas of improvement or efficiency to further strengthen performance in the channel.
• Ensure art files are output ready and available to meet production schedule requirements
